| Detection Item | Common Analytical Method | Method Overview |
|---|---|---|
| Assay (Purity) | HPLC-UV | Quantifies main component using reverse-phase chromatography with UV detection at characteristic wavelength. |
| Related Substances | HPLC-UV | Separates and quantifies structurally similar impurities based on retention time and peak area. |
| Residual Solvents | GC-FID | Detects and quantifies volatile organic solvents using flame ionization detection after gas chromatographic separation. |
| Water Content | Karl Fischer Titration | Measures water by coulometric or volumetric titration with iodine-based reagent in anhydrous methanol. |
| Heavy Metals | ICP-OES | Determines total heavy metal content (e.g., Pb, Cd, Hg, Ni) via atomic emission spectroscopy after acid digestion. |
| Chloride Impurity | Ion Chromatography | Separates and quantifies chloride ions using suppressed conductivity detection after anion exchange. |
| Melting Point | Capillary Melting Point Apparatus | Measures temperature range at which solid transitions to liquid, indicating crystallinity and purity. |
| Appearance | Visual Inspection | Assesses physical state, color, and presence of visible particulates or discoloration under controlled lighting. |
| Bulk Density | USP <616> Method I | Determines mass per unit volume of freely settled powder using calibrated cylinder and balance. |
| Particle Size Distribution | Laser Diffraction | Measures size distribution by analyzing angular scattering pattern of laser light passed through dispersed sample. |
| Loss on Drying | Gravimetric Analysis | Determines volatile content by measuring weight loss after heating at specified temperature under controlled conditions. |
| Residue on Ignition | Gravimetric Analysis | Quantifies inorganic residue remaining after high-temperature ashing of sample in platinum crucible. |
